Self-Help Print Collection at James E. Faust Law Library (University of Utah)

Below is a demonstrative list of some of the titles available in our print collection. Other self-help titles can be found by doing a search of our library catalog on our home page or by coming to the library and browsing our self-help collection located on the first floor of the law school.

Did you know...

Searching the catalog from the law library homepage automatically searches the Marriott Library and Eccles Health Sciences Library catalogs as well. This saves you time and expands your search power.

Print Legal Forms

The library maintains a large collection of print legal forms including:

  • American Jurisprudence Legal Forms
  • Current Legal Forms with Tax Analysis
  • Nichol's Cyclopedia of Legal Forms Annotated
  • West's Legal Forms
